Freeman Wills Crofts

Birthplace

What is recorded here

Freeman Wills Crofts was born in Dublin, Ireland, on 1 June 1879, the same year his father died of fever in Honduras. That absence may have shaped the boy who grew up in a vicarage and later built railways across Northern Ireland. He turned his engineering mind to detective fiction, creating Inspector French and writing puzzles as precise as bridge joints.

Why this person is known: Irish mystery author (1879–1957)
